I believe this model may have been made at the famous FujiGen factory in Japan, though I do not have documentation to confirm that. FujiGen is a legendary Japanese guitar factory known for producing high-quality instruments and later manufacturing Fender Japan guitars, among many other respected brands. So I’m listing that as “believed to be” rather than as a guaranteed claim.
